Once your 3D build has completed, the part on the platform is considered
green
until it has been through post-processing. A green part must be
handled with nitrile gloves at all times. This section describes how to post-process the part, rendering it safe to handle without nitrile gloves. You
will need lint-free paper towels (or absorbent cloth) to catch print material that may drip from the part, as well as two stainless-steel or
glass containers in which to submerge the part in your solvent of choice.

CAUTION: Always follow the precautions noted in the SDS (Safety Data Sheets) for any print material or solvent being used. It is
important to limit the exposure of the resin tray to light, as too much exposure will begin to solidify the material inside it and render it
unsuitable for part building. Place resin-tray cover over resin tray when not in use, close the printer door, or empty the material
from the resin tray back into a bottle of the same material, and seal the bottle.

1. Allow the printed part to drain over the resin tray until material stops dripping off the part. Once this is
done, open the printer lid. You will see the screen below on the printer:
2. Wearing nitrile gloves, tilt the print platform over the resin tray such that any remaining material is
drained into the resin tray.
3. Place a paper towel or gloved hand under the part and lift the print platform out of the machine. The
paper towel will keep print material from dripping on unwanted surfaces.
